Live cam platforms appearance effortless from the entrance row. A performer goes reside, visitors pile into a room, messages and suggestions fly across the display, and the entirety feels instant. Behind that comfortable floor sits a stack of procedures that behave extra like air traffic management than a video participant. Getting a digicam feed from a residing room in Bucharest to a cell on resort Wi‑Fi in Dallas, protecting interplay underneath a 2nd, and making the cash aspect settle adequately, all whereas staying inside of regional regulation, is what makes or breaks an Adult Cam Site. Teams construction Fap Cam Chat reviews, even if below brands like xFap Chat or Fap Chat, clear up the same families of trouble with tight constraints and plenty shifting materials.
What follows is a area manual to how the center portions in good shape in combination, the place they fail, and what possibilities professional engineers make after they need performance that still behaves beneath pressure.
The first hop from camera to platform
Everything starts at seize. Most broadcasters both use a browser with WebRTC getUserMedia, a machine encoder like OBS or Streamlabs, or a cellular app. Brower capture is the simplest to onboard, and xfap.chat it offers the platform keep watch over over formats and bitrate by using WebRTC. OBS, on the other hand, still exhibits up as it handles scene composition, chroma key, and diverse audio resources with fewer surprises. Mobile SDKs round it out with hardware encoders that are battery pleasant.
On a regular pc browser, the platform requests a video observe at 720p to 1080p. https://www.xfap.chat/ If you ask for 1080p30 and let the browser negotiate H.264 restricted baseline at 3 to 6 Mbps, you land in a sweet spot for high-quality with no making much less in a position visitors buffer. On cellular, 720p at 2 to three Mbps is wide-spread when the digicam and uplink behave. Dual mono AAC at ninety six to 128 kbps presents easy voice and room tone devoid of chewing bandwidth.
The ingest URL or WebRTC supply plays the position of a move key. The platform ties this credential to a selected broadcaster identification, enforces geo or content regulations perfect away, and returns future health tips to come back to the consumer. Round go back and forth time, outbound bitrate, dropped frames, and keyframe durations are the four numbers a writer dashboard must always surface in human terms. If the broadcaster’s personal computer is thermal throttling and dropping from 30 fps to twelve fps, they need a purple gentle and a touch to near Chrome tabs previously the room fills.
Protocol options and industry‑offs in latency
Three real looking beginning patterns display up throughout reside cam platforms:
- WebRTC stop to stop with SRTP, for sub‑second interactive rooms. RTMP ingest plus low latency HLS (LL‑HLS) for scale to hundreds of thousands with 2 to five second put off. Hybrid, the place the broadcaster uses WebRTC into the platform, the platform routes WebRTC to interactive audience, and enthusiasts watching passively drop into LL‑HLS.
Pick the incorrect one and also you listen it all of a sudden in a performer’s timing. WebRTC does fantastic for tip reactions, video games, and two‑manner or organization shows. HLS, inspite of low latency CMAF chunking, helps to keep expenses predictable and handles hearth‑and‑forget passive visitors on wise TVs and older units. Hybrid setups help you hold the chat in lockstep for the prime few thousand active visitors at the same time as you fan out cheaper segments to lengthy‑tail traffic.
The exhausting side is device diversity. iOS Safari will simplest hardware decode H.264 internal HLS devoid of designated allowances, whilst personal computer Chrome fortunately blasts VP9 over WebRTC. Your participant stack needs fallback logic, and the ABR ladder would have to include a H.264 rung even if your center loves AV1.
How the media is routed: mesh, MCU, and SFU
Once media lands, it's important to pass it to many eyeballs with as little duplication as possible. Three topologies exist, and simplest one scales cleanly for cam rooms.
- Mesh: every participant sends media to each other participant. It is high-quality for small community calls under five americans, yet it crushes the broadcaster’s uplink as the room grows. MCU: a server decodes each and every incoming observe, mixes it into a composite, then re‑encodes a single circulate out. Math is predictable, but you lose in step with‑viewer control and your CPU bill climbs fast. SFU: a selective forwarding unit receives tracks, does now not decode them, and routes consistent with‑viewer. You retailer stop‑to‑finish encryption, that you can build simulcast or SVC ladders, and servers keep cool.
Most Adult Cam Site teams decide on SFUs at the sting, incessantly with reference to best peering issues. If a performer’s packets trip 30 ms to an SFU in Frankfurt rather than one hundred twenty ms to a single primary sector, you advantage headroom. Modern SFUs take into account simulcast, so the broadcaster can ship three layers, let's say 1080p, 540p, and 270p. The SFU then forwards simplest the layer each one viewer can care for. That one selection cuts transcoding expenditures through orders of magnitude and boosts first-class for shaky cellphone visitors.
Getting through the net’s tough edges
Residential net behaves badly. NATs mangle ports, Wi‑Fi drops 1 % of packets simply considering the fact that person closes a microwave, and service networks rewrite TCP timeouts. WebRTC ships with STUN and TURN to poke holes in NATs or relay whilst all else fails. TURN is the hidden tax on low‑latency video. If 15 to 25 p.c. of periods relay through TURN in a given zone, you consider it at the bandwidth invoice. Careful anycast and quarter placement bring that range down.
Once packets are flowing, SRTP with RTCP suggestions permits you to do selective retransmissions, and ahead blunders correction covers burst losses. A jitter buffer of 60 to a hundred and twenty ms is a basic compromise. Raise it while the community is flaky, scale back it whilst the room wants snappy reactions. On appropriate of that, congestion management algorithms like Google Congestion Control modify bitrate goal each and every few hundred milliseconds. The trick is letting the broadcaster ramp up after a temporary with out oscillating wildly. I have noticeable rooms where a 500 kbps floor and a 2.5 Mbps ceiling saved things sturdy, however a 0 kbps surface brought on spirals anytime a neighbor grew to become on Netflix.
Transcoding or not, and the ABR ladder
Transcoding supplies you freedom at a cost. GPU nodes with NVENC or really expert ASICs can produce numerous rungs right away, however you pay in the two funds and heat. Simulcast reduces the desire to transcode the broadcaster’s video, but you still generate HLS renditions for passive playback and archives.
Reasonable ladders for a performer’s unmarried camera reveal appear to be this in follow:
1080p at 30 fps around four.5 to 6 Mbps.
720p at 30 fps around 2.five to three.5 Mbps.
480p at 30 fps around 900 to 1,2 hundred kbps.
360p at 30 fps round 500 to 800 kbps.
Audio at 96 to 128 kbps AAC.
Keyframes at two seconds retain are living scrubbing responsive. For LL‑HLS, target 500 ms chunks and three components per segment so the player can pull statistics regularly. The server pipeline have got to deal with partial segment shipping and grasp simply sufficient buffer to steer clear of stalls. If you use CMAF, verify memory force while 10000 rooms go are living simultaneously, as a result of every one open record deal with and reminiscence map adds up.
Chat, tricks, and precise‑time experience
The chat layer consists of the character of a coach. The finest ones journey a WebSocket or WebTransport channel and use a pub/sub spine behind the scenes. Redis streams or Kafka topics deal with fanout, and a presence provider tracks who's within the room. You prefer message supply below one hundred ms median and below three hundred ms at the 95th percentile so that chat and video think in sync.
Tipping is a separate nervous approach. Money messages have to be idempotent, ordered, and auditable. A undemanding trend uses a write‑forward log with monotonically growing IDs according to room. The purchaser sends a signed aim, the server reserves balance, posts the end to the log, then confirms to all subscribers. If any step fails after cash are reserved, a compensating transaction releases them. The badge that pops over the video, the sound impact, the reaction at the performer’s side, and the stock decrement for a purpose bar should all study from the similar experience to prevent double credits or overlooked acknowledgments.
Moderation methods suit within the chat transport. Rate limits slow troublemakers. Shadow bans defend room vibe devoid of beginning fights. Automatic textual content classifiers cast off noticeable unsolicited mail and prohibited phrases, however human moderators maintain part instances. If you enable two‑way private shows, you also need consent activates and a way to freeze the consultation if both area reports abuse.
Payments, compliance, and risk
Adult funds are their own game. Card networks observe bigger scrutiny, and chargeback fees for cam web sites can drift between zero.5 and 1.five percent relying on industry and incentives. Strong Customer Authentication in Europe way 3-D Secure for initial a lot. Digital wallets and local techniques count: Pix in Brazil, SEPA in ingredients of the EU, and open banking thoughts inside the UK reduce expenses and building up approval quotes.
On the payout edge, creators go through KYC. A universal go with the flow verifies identity, exams in opposition to watchlists, and collects tax bureaucracy the place mandatory. Holding classes differ from just a few days to per week or extra relying on processor possibility appetite. Automating the threshold situations will pay off, to illustrate reminding a creator to refresh an expired ID two weeks prior to payout date. I have obvious that unmarried workflow reduce assist tickets via a third.
Compliance runs deeper. Age verification for performers is non‑negotiable. Region regulations follow to the two content and get admission to, so you have to put in force geo blocks at the threshold. DMCA or identical takedown methods dwell in tooling that lets rights holders assert claims with out bringing down professional displays. Storage retention regulations keep personal info for handiest as long as required, and audit logs lock in opposition t tampering.
Security, privateness, and content protection
Everything sensitive moves over TLS. For media, WebRTC uses DTLS and SRTP with flawless forward secrecy. Session cookies lift HttpOnly and SameSite flags, and CSRF tokens canopy nation‑replacing endpoints. Broadcasters needs to get two‑aspect authentication and system approvals. IP overlaying maintains writer areas private, and admin resources want strict access regulate with recorded moves.
No customer platform can give up reveal trap outright, yet that you would be able to carry the bar. Watermarking overlays that come with a viewer fingerprint help hint leaks. Some websites rotate those fingerprints periodically and render them with minor random offsets so uncomplicated plants do no longer cast off them. On the participant area, set the document to require consumer gestures to go into full display screen. On the server aspect, reveal L7 styles and consumer sellers general for scraping. None of this is perfect, but it reduces common abuse.
Observability and the way groups keep sane
When a performer says the movement is lagging, you want statistics, no longer vibes. A strong telemetry package deal contains in keeping with‑consultation around go back and forth time, outbound and inbound bitrate, body expense, dropped frames, codec and profile, jitter, NACK and PLI counts, and rebuffer ratio from gamers. At populace degree, observe startup time to first frame, traditional watch time, and errors premiums by ISP and region.
I like a 3‑tier view. First, a live room dashboard that the author toughen workforce can open although on chat, with colour coding, final minute trendlines, and realistic information like lower bitrate to two Mbps. Second, a community operations panel that presentations SFU future health, TURN usage, and in step with‑sector anomalies. Third, a post‑mortem timeline that correlates application logs, SFU situations, and CDN mistakes so engineers can prove or disprove hypotheses at once.
Synthetic probes aid. A farm of headless avid gamers inside the excellent twenty ISPs, starting and stopping rooms each and every minute, catches regressions early. If a browser update alterations H.264 stage negotiation, you spot it sooner than the weekend rush.
Capacity planning and the instant every part spikes
Cam site visitors is peaky. A single performer can move viral on a social clip, and ten thousand followers land in underneath two minutes. Autoscaling companies handle stable development, however chilly starts hurt true customers. Warm pools of SFU and signaling nodes, already joined to the cluster and drained of visitors unless considered necessary, keep the day. You additionally want backpressure. If a vicinity is at means, you can redirect passive visitors to LL‑HLS, train an straightforward wait message for interactive mode, or path to the next closest aspect.
Circuit breakers hinder cascading failures. If the token carrier or bills API blips, the rest of the gadget needs to degrade gracefully. Cache room metadata for a couple of minutes, queue noncritical writes, and prevent streams working. When the dependency comes to come back, reconcile. Human runbooks remember. At 2 a.m., clean steps that a responder can keep on with with out paging six teams cut down downtime.
Building tools that creators literally use
Creators do not need to be informed community theory. They prefer a overall healthiness panel that speaks their language. A proper broadcaster console surfaces solely what a author needs to act on, with transparent thresholds and concrete activities.
- A preflight check that checks digital camera, mic, purchasable uplink, and firewall reachability, with one button to drop answer if the uplink fails. Live stats with eco-friendly, yellow, crimson bands for bitrate, frame rate, and keyframe c program languageperiod, plus quick suggestion like close historical past uploads. A riskless resync button that renegotiates the WebRTC session with no killing the room, for while a driver hiccups. Quick content material controls together with one‑faucet gradual mode, a mute‑concerned with chat, and depended on moderator invites with scoped permissions. Goal and tip gear that permit the performer set ambitions, attach sounds or outcomes, and take a look at them with out charging every body.
Small match-and-conclude small print rely. Snap a thumbnail each and every 30 seconds while the room is public, so looking customers see a dwell peek. Add a preview meter for computer audio to steer clear of shock silence. Let creators schedule exhibits and auto‑tweet or publish to their lovers at go‑live, with guardrails to stop unintentional hyperlinks that violate platform coverage.
The knowledge version for rooms and presence
At the center of the gadget, a room is a document with nation transitions: scheduled, dwell, paused, ended. Presence is a suite of viewers that become a member of and leave quickly. You favor to retain hot records in reminiscence retail outlets which includes Redis with short TTL, and push room hobbies to long lasting logs like Kafka for analytics and billing.
Sharding suggestions changed into worthwhile at scale. If you shard by way of room ID, some mega rooms can hot‑spot a shard. If you shard by geographic area or hash of either room and sector, you unfold the load. Keep go‑room operations out of the recent course. For example, the worldwide trending listing will likely be computed asynchronously by using eating the match circulation and calculating a rank ranking that blends viewer matter, tip pace, and room age.
For storage of clips and highlights, object retail outlets win. Content addressable identifiers save you duplication whilst creators keep segments. Lifecycle regulations movement historical content material to chillier degrees. If you permit content material evaluation or compliance holds, shop derived hashes and fingerprints so that you can discover re‑uploads right now.
Player behavior on truly devices
Browsers bring quirks that tutor up on the worst time. iOS requires person gestures for autoplay with sound, so your player ought to preload video muted and instructed the consumer to unmute. Backgrounding on telephone can droop timers and WebRTC packet scheduling, then go back with a flood of queued callbacks. Test your country mechanical device beneath these situations. On computing device, hardware acceleration can disappear if yet one more app grabs the GPU. When that happens, CPU utilization spikes and drops frames with out obtrusive rationale. A watchdog that notices regular neglected vsync can suggested the user to lessen solution or swap browsers.
Different formats offer their personal traps. H.264 licensing pushes some groups to keep away from hardware encoders on the server, then they uncover that application encoders under load introduce latency at exactly the viewer height. VP9 facilitates fine in keeping with bit but struggles on older iOS. AV1 is exciting. In constrained A/Bs, 1080p AV1 at three Mbps looked as right as 1080p H.264 at 5 Mbps, but deciphering on midrange Androids nevertheless burns battery. Today, most cam web sites send H.264 because the baseline and scan with AV1 on personal computer and excessive‑finish mobile.
Cost discipline with out wrecking quality
Every structure desire has a line item. Outbound egress from a CDN runs from fractions of a cent to three cents per GB at amount. TURN relaying is greater high-priced simply because you pay each compute and knowledge. GPU transcoders price money in line with hour, and idle occasions are natural waste.
A few levers supply outsized discounts. Push simulcast from the broadcaster so your SFU does routing, no longer re‑encoding. Use neighborhood‑aware routing to hold TURN utilization below 10 %. Cache HLS segments at the threshold and set related cache regulate for brief home windows so repeat audience hammer the CDN, now not your starting place. Benchmark GPU versions. On one workload, we saw a 25 percent enchancment in frames in line with dollar with the aid of shifting from older T4s to L4s and pinning encoders to cores as opposed to letting the scheduler roam.
Account for beef up rates too. Every factor of clarity you add to the broadcaster console reduces tickets. Support labor hardly ever displays up within the “tech” price range, but the viewer enjoy is dependent on it.
Monitoring safety with out killing the vibe
Safety is nonnegotiable, yet heavy‑exceeded gear turn creators and visitors away. Modern techniques combination automation and men and women. On the automated part, text filters catch noticeable violations and spam. Computer imaginative and prescient items can flag on the topic of scenes to human reviewers devoid of storing or exposing extra than beneficial. Region guidelines will also be enforced with the aid of IP, yet additionally by fee strategy place and software indications to preclude trivial VPN bypasses.
Human assessment teams want context and time‑bounded get entry to. Give them the previous couple of mins of buffered content, chat logs for that window, and the potential to mark a choice with cause codes. Train them with sensible side situations. The intention is consistent judgements that save the platform prison and the neighborhood depended on.
How manufacturers like xFap Chat and Fap Chat put in force the similar ideas
The branding would differ, yet a Fap Cam Chat room tends to run on a similar spine. The distinctiveness suggests up in product preferences. One model may perhaps lean into interactive video games the place info trigger on‑reveal ameliorations in proper time, so they double down on WebRTC and music SFU placement near author clusters. Another may prioritize a mag‑like browsing event with seamless clip previews, so they put money into precomputed HLS sprites and low latency clip startup rather then ultra low latency rooms. Both remain Adult Cam Site implementations, each balancing settlement, attain, and the type of intimacy they sell.
The most beneficial teams deliver a bias for size. When xFap Chat experiments with a brand new AV1 rung, they roll it to five p.c. of desktop Chrome site visitors and stay up for watch time, rebuffer expense, and chat pace deltas. When Fap Chat adjusts tipping animations, they test rendering time on low‑quit Android phones to evade dropped frames appropriate while the room is so much spirited. These are small loops, repeated weekly, that store the platform speedy and pleasant.
What the near long term holds
Three moves feel geared up now. First, LL‑HLS has matured to the point in which a mixed WebRTC plus LL‑HLS system can carry interactive rooms to energetic followers and more affordable scale to anyone else without a jarring lengthen change. Second, AV1 is rolling into telephones and laptops speedy. As decode support saturates, AV1 will allow cam rooms increase fine at the equal bitrate, or hinder first-class and keep cash. Third, QUIC and WebTransport open new alternate options for chat or even media in the browser. The capacity to multiplex streams, preclude head‑of‑line blocking off, and cope with partial reliability will simplify a few gnarly edges.
None of these eradicate the fundamentals. Clear overall healthiness signals for creators, good routing at the edge, a chat course that not ever drops a paid message, and observability that resolves disputes quickly are what make the expertise suppose human. When they work, a performer can learn the room, tease a milestone, and deliver a show that feels are living in each sense. The know-how has done its job when no one thinks about it.